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To reduce a cost required for maintaining a water supply by utilizing rain water falling on a high level road to supply the water required for plants when greening the site under an elevating structure. <P>SOLUTION: A water-collecting pit (3) for storing the rain water falling on the high level road (1) through an aqueduct (2) is installed in the site under the elevating structure, and the stored rain water is introduced to a U-slot made of a porous concrete, and installed along a retaining wall (6) of a service road (5). The water required for the plants are fed by passing the rain water through the porous slot wall of the U-slot so as to penetrate into the soil (8) of a plantation ground under the elevating structure formed in the vicinity of the U-slot. If necessary, the tip part (2a) of the aqueduct (2) is formed so as to be turned. The surface of the planted ground is covered with a nonwoven fabric, and Lippia repens is used as a greening plant.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2003,JPO

Means adopted by the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ings. 1. A catchment basin (3) for storing rainwater on the elevated road (1) via a water conduit (2) is provided under the elevated structure. The stored rainwater is introduced into the U-shaped groove (7) made of porous concrete provided along the retaining wall (6) of the side road (5) by the water supply pipe (4). Permeating through the groove wall (7a) of the porous structure of the U-shaped groove, the rainwater exudes into the soil (8) of the elevated underplanting site provided adjacent to the U-shaped groove as shown by the arrow. By doing so, the water supply necessary for planting will be provided.

2. In the cold season, when anti-freezing agents and snow-melting agents are used on elevated roads, rainwater containing these chemicals is harmful to planting, so it is necessary to cut off the water. Therefore, the tip portion (2a) of the water conduit (2) is rotatably formed by a flexible joint or the like, and the broken line (2)
As shown in b), the tip portion (2a) is rotated so that the course of the rainwater to the collecting basin (3) can be converted to another drainage channel (a normal drainage channel not shown).

3. In order to prevent unnecessary evaporation of rainwater that has exuded into the soil (8), as shown in FIG. 2, the planting ground under the viaduct is covered with a nonwoven fabric (9) that has an effect of suppressing evaporation of moisture in the soil. To do.

B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ION When dust on elevated roads, rubber powder of tires, etc. are carried along with rainwater, clogging occurs in the groove wall of the perforated U-shaped groove. Equipped with a filter on the top.

Since the amount of rainfall varies depending on the season, the amount of water supply is adjusted by operating the water supply valve provided on the water supply pipe (4). In particular, during the period when water supply to the catchment basin (3) is stopped by using antifreezing agents and snow-melting agents on the elevated roads, the water supply volume is narrowed and the rainwater stored in the catchment basin is efficiently used. To use.

As the non-woven fabric (9) for covering the planting ground, for example, a non-woven fabric of polylactic acid fiber made from starch as a raw material or a non-woven fabric of natural fiber such as recycled wool is used for ground cover plants. These non-woven fabrics are biodegradable, and act as weed preventers until the ground cover covers the ground, and then naturally collapse and disappear. For trees, a non-woven fabric of recycled polyester fibers is used for its permanent weed control effect. Each of the above-mentioned non-woven fabrics has an effect of suppressing the evaporation of moisture in the soil, and can reduce 50% or more of the amount of moisture evaporation when the ground is not covered. It is desirable to use a non-woven fabric having such an effect in order to efficiently use rainwater that has been led to the planting area.

The green plant (10) used in the present invention can be arbitrarily selected, and among them, Hime-iwadareso is preferable.
Since Himeiwadareso is a ground cover plant, it has a high spreading speed to cover the ground and is resistant to drying, so it withstands the delay of water supply,
It is hard to be injured by pests and blooms from May to early October, and small pink flowers bloom all over,
Useful for beautifying the road landscape.
